Electromechanical Engineer (Electronics Packaging)

Key Responsibilities and Activities

  • Design, integrate, and test lightweight enclosures for high voltage power electronic devices
  • Aid in the identification of appropriate electric motors, and develop powertrain components with an emphasis on
    • Low weight
    • High reliability
    • Electromagnetic compatibility
    • Heat rejection
  • Develop cooling for power electronics, including the refinement of thermal models, modeling of liquid and gaseous fluid flow, and the design of heat sinks or other thermal management components
  • Develop or refine heating systems for temperature sensitive components
  • Assist in the integration of electronic components into a larger liquid or air-cooling system
  • Assist in the design of battery and electronic component housings to meet crashworthiness requirements
  • Specify materials, coatings and components to resist environmental attack and ensure compliance with Electromagnetic Compatibility (EMC)
  • Provide CAD work in support of design activities, including directing drafting and product definition staff and application of good drawing habits and industry best-practices for GD&T
  • Support and participate in testing activities – component, drive, and/or flight – as needed, including test plan creation, data analysis, and test report generation and documentation
  • Support the Certification Director with compliance and certification activities and best practices, including design, test, and analysis documentation, internal and external audits, and other activities as needed
  • Participate as a key player in the design-build-test process for the Transition®, including conceptual, preliminary and detailed design, requirements definition, design reviews, prototyping, and testing
  • Coordinate and communicate effectively with other engineers, technical personnel, and management
